1

我怀疑我错过了明显的,但我无法让下面的工作。

我正在尝试创建一个自定义开/关开关,但是当我加载页面时,我会遇到一个错误 -

$(...).switchButton 不是函数

我已经jQuery/jQueryUI包括在内,甚至在页面上还有一个jQuery微调器的实例,它曾经使用.widget().

有人可以告诉我我做错了什么吗?

(function($){

    $.widget('DDUI.switchButton', {

        options: {
            tester: 'This plugin is working...'
        }, // options

        _create: function(){
            console.log(this.options.tester);
        } // _create

    })

});

$(document).ready(function(){
    $('input#switch_test').switchButton();
});
4

1 回答 1

0

我现在已经解决了这个问题。

只需替换这个 -

(function($){

有了这个 -

$(function(){
于 2013-11-07T10:26:57.717 回答